RENOVA ® (tretinoin cream) 0.02% is indicated as an adjunctive agent (see second bullet point below) for use in the mitigation (palliation) of fine facial wrinkles in patients who use comprehensive skin care and sunlight avoidance programs. RENOVA is a prescription medicine that may reduce fine facial wrinkles. It must be used under the guidance of your doctor as part of a total skin-care and sunlight-avoidance program. RENOVA (tretinoin cream) 0.02% should be used under medical supervision as an adjunct to a comprehensive skin care and sunlight avoidance program that includes the use of effective sunscreens (minimum SPF of 15) and protective clothing. Renova is a form of vitamin A that helps the skin renew itself. Renova Cream will help treat, but will not cure fine wrinkles, spotty skin discoloration, and rough feeling skin.
